Simple day to day lifestyle modifications can help keep our liver healthy- Experts

Pune : One of the important organs, Liver carries out multiple functions including detoxification, metabolism, digestion, immunity and many other. But improper lifestyle has been significantly impacted liver health. However Simple day to day lifestyle modifications can help keep our liver healthy, opined experts.

The World Liver Day on 19 April highlights the importance of this vital organ . This year’s theme is “Food is Medicine,” with a goal of educating the public that eating a balanced diet can help prevent liver disease and ensure proper liver function.

Dr Pramod Katare – Consultant Gastroenterologist, Hepatologist and Therapeutic GI Endoscopist. At Noble Hospital and Research Centre said that improper lifestyle and diet full of sugar and fat, refined flour is a major risk factor for fatty liver in today’s times. If neglected over a period of time it can cause irreversible damage to the liver. The major concern is that many of the patients approaching us are young in their late twenties and early thirties. Our liver does not show any symptoms till it is damaged to about 80%. So, the damage continues silently till a stage where it can become irreversible. Most of the time fatty liver is asymptomatic, although the common symptoms include fatigue. People get diagnosed with fatty liver during health checkups or when they present with some other conditions like acidity. The condition is rapidly becoming as common as obesity or hypertension. However, this can be reversed if people become aware of fatty liver. Taking into consideration today’s lifestyle and diet of the working population, a simple blood test (liver function test- LFT) and if required sonography can help detect fatty liver in early stages. Those with a rather bad lifestyle may go in for LFT post the age of 25 years. Whenever any patient is diagnosed with fatty liver at early stages, we recommend simple lifestyle modifications like diet and exercise. If it does not work then medicines are prescribed. Intermittent fasting if done properly helps but many people go too far to reduce weight which will not help. Only diet is not enough, diet coupled with exercise is the key to get rid of fatty liver.
